Ingredients: For the Carrot Cake Base:

  • 2 cups grated carrots
  • 1 cup dates, pitted
  • 1 cup walnuts
  • 1 cup almonds
  • 1/2 cup shredded coconut
  • 1/2 cup raisins
  • 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
  • 1/2 teaspoon ground nutmeg
  • Pinch of salt

For the Vegan Cream Cheese Frosting:

  • 1 cup cashews, soaked in water for at least 4 hours
  • 1/4 cup coconut oil, melted
  • 1/4 cup maple syrup or agave nectar
  • 1 tablespoon lemon juice
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• Pinch of salt

Optional Toppings:

  • Chopped nuts
  • Shredded coconut
  • Edible flowers for garnish

Instructions:

  1. Prepare the Carrot Cake Base:
    • In a food processor, combine grated carrots, pitted dates, walnuts, almonds, shredded coconut, raisins, ground cinnamon, ground nutmeg, and a pinch of salt. Process until the mixture reaches a sticky, crumbly consistency.
  2. Press into Pan:
    • Line a cake pan with parchment paper. Transfer the carrot cake mixture into the pan and press it down firmly and evenly, creating a compact base. Ensure the edges are well-defined.
  3. Chill the Base:
    • Place the pan in the refrigerator to chill while preparing the vegan cream cheese frosting.
  4. Prepare the Vegan Cream Cheese Frosting:
    • In a high-speed blender, combine soaked cashews, melted coconut oil, maple syrup or agave nectar, lemon juice, vanilla extract, and a pinch of salt. Blend until smooth and creamy.
  5. Spread Frosting Over the Base:
    • Retrieve the chilled carrot cake base from the refrigerator. Pour the vegan cream cheese frosting over the base, spreading it evenly with a spatula.
  6. Chill and Set:
    • Return the pan to the refrigerator and let the cake chill for at least 4 hours or until the frosting is set. This allows the flavors to meld and the cake to achieve the desired consistency.
  7. Garnish with Delight:
    • Before serving, garnish the Vegan No-Bake Carrot Cake with chopped nuts, shredded coconut, and edible flowers for a touch of visual elegance.
  8. Slice and Serve:
    • Using a sharp knife, slice the chilled cake into squares or slices. Serve on a decorative platter or individual dessert plates.

Nutritional Information: Our Vegan No-Bake Carrot Cake is a guilt-free indulgence that combines wholesome ingredients to create a dessert rich in vitamins, minerals, and plant-based goodness. Carrots offer beta-carotene, walnuts and almonds provide healthy fats, and dates contribute natural sweetness. The vegan cream cheese frosting, made from cashews and coconut oil, adds a luscious texture without the need for dairy.
